    I don’t know if this is an Akismet issue or a WP issue (or even a host issue; my blog is not on wordpress.com); I’ve contacted the Akismet people with the problem as well.

    When I use the “Plugin Editor” page of my Admin panel to try to edit akismet.php (this happens whether or not Akismet is currently enabled), I get a 503 error when I click “Update File,” and the file doesn’t get changed. It’s not a truly general problem, because I can edit other plugins just fine. It’s also not a glitch–I’ve tried this multiple times, over a couple of weeks now, always with the same result.

    This isn’t like the 503 errors involving Akismet that I’ve been able to find posts about–this isn’t a 503 error produced on one of my public blog pages; it actually happens in the Admin panel itself.
